Reliability Metrics 101: Mean Time to Failure (MTTF) - MaxGrip
WEBMean Time to Failure (MTTF) measures the average operating time to failure for a non-repairable similar assets or components. A non-repairable asset is an asset that is typically replaced rather than repaired when it fails. MTTF = Operating time to failure (in hours) / Number of assets in use.

What’s the Difference Between MTTR, MTTD, MTTF, and MTBF?
WEBMTTF stands for mean time to failure. This is the average lifespan of a given device. Mean time to failure is calculated by adding up the lifespans of all the devices, and dividing it by their count. MTTF = total lifespan across devices / # of devices.
